

Your Microsoft 365 subscription plan must include Outlook (there are subscription plans without Outlook). In the top left corner, click the menu icon to open the menu with the list of applications available for your user account in Microsoft 365. Open Outlook Online in your web browser by visiting the web address. Let’s start and import contacts to Outlook Online. Outlook Online is an online application that is a component of the Microsoft 365 suite.
Instructions to import contacts in office 365 how to#
How to Import Contacts into Outlook Online? There is a prerequisite: You should have a CSV file with contacts exported beforehand for all the scenarios covered in this blog post. This blog post explains how to import contacts into Outlook in three scenarios – using Outlook Online in Microsoft 365 with the graphical user interface, Microsoft Office Outlook installed in Windows, and Outlook Online with the command line interface of PowerShell. If you migrate from one email platform to another or from one email client to another, you can export and import both emails and contact lists. Write-Host -ForegroundColor Yellow "Notice: No file(s) selected.By Michael Bose A Guide on How to Import Contacts to Outlook 365Įmail users usually save the addresses of other users to a contact list or address book. $Dialog.InitialDirectory = "$InitialDirectory" Please note ‘param’ might show warning messages, but you can ignore it.Īdd-Type -AssemblyName We are creating the system pop-up dialog box for importing the CSV file. (Importing the session so that all the commands like New-MailContact, New-MailBox, etc. PS C:\Windows\system32> import-PSSession -session $s

(Getting the session generated from the exchange server for remote connectivity and storing it in the variable s) PS C:\Windows\system32> $s=New-PSSession -ConfigurationName Microsoft.Exchange -ConnectionUri -credential $UserCredential -Authentication Basic -AllowRedirection PS C:\Windows\system32> $UserCredential=Get-Credential (Provide the server administrator credentials) Yes Yes to All No No to All Suspend Help (default is "N"): Y Do you want to change the execution policy? Changing the execution policy might expose you to the security risks described in the about_Execution_Policies help topic at The execution policy helps protect you from scripts that you do not trust.

PS C:\Windows\system32 > Set-ExecutionPolicy RemoteSigned (Setting Up Execution Policy and set it RemoteSigned). If any column is left blank, it will not be imported into the GAL. You must fill out these two mandatory columns for each contact. If any of the employees do not have an email address, exclude those records from this list because those cannot be processed and imported. Please note that you must provide an email address for each contact. Create a contact CSV (comma-separated value) file containing the following headers.Ģ. Here are the instructions on how to use PowerShell for importing multiple contacts using a. To bulk import contacts, one of the efficient ways is to use PowerShell.

Microsoft 365 portal doesn't offer you an easy way to import multiple contacts into your company's Global Address List (GAL), unlike the Contacts app as service.
